WebDec 25, 2013 · To clarify, you typically don't use scp to copy a file to or from your local machine (System A) while logged in to a remote server (System B) with ssh.scp will log you into the remote server, copy the file, then log you out again in one process, so just run it from a shell on your local machine. WebSep 22, 2024 · To connect to a remote host using the terminal, the user issues the ssh command followed by the username and the server address or hostname: ssh [username]@ [server_ip_or_hostname] For example: Note: If you do not specify a username for SSH, the connection uses the currently logged in user. WebSep 7, 2024 · To create a new SSH key, use the ssh-keygen command: $ ssh-keygen -t ed25519 -f ~/.ssh/lan The -t option stands for type and ensures that the encryption used for the key is higher than the default.
